Capítulo 4 As Interfaces do Sistema

Propaganda
Capítulo 4
As Interfaces do Sistema
Neste capítulo nós trataremos a respeito das formas de interação do usuário com o sistema computacional. Traçando uma comparação entre as interfaces à caracteres e as interfaces gráficas. Observando seu principais elementos e características. 4.1 Interfaces
Interfaces, no domínio da computação, representa os mecanismos de interação que possibilitam a manipulação do sistema de informações computacional. As interfaces podem ser classificadas como baseadas à caractere (interface textual) ou gráfica (interface visual).
4.1.2 Interface à Caractere
As primeiras interfaces de interação dos usuários com o computador foram baseadas em caracteres. Basicamente, estas interfaces se resumiam em interpretadores de comandos, programas que tinham a função receber comandos, interpretá­los e executar as tarefas correspondentes. Tarefas estas que, em sua maioria, eram referentes à manipulação de arquivos (criação, movimentação, exclusão e alteração). Os interpretadores de comando também eram responsáveis pela carga das aplicações e pelo fluxo de informações entre elas. Hoje em dia ainda encontramos, nos sistemas operacionais modernos, formas de interação através de interpretadores de comados, por exemplo: bash, do Unix e; shell, do Linux; command.com, MSDOS e na plataforma Windows.
Figura 2: Prompt de comando
Figura 1: Consola de comandos
A partir da década de 60, as interações dos usuários eram realizadas através de interfaces à caractere, nas duas décadas seguintes começaram a surgir as primeiras interfaces gráficas.
4.1.3 Interfaces Gráficas
As interfaces gráficas através de elementos visuais, tais como: ícones, menus, cursores, ponteiros, botões e janelas; fornecem uma forma fácil de interagir com o computador. As interações, nestas interfaces, são perfeitas combinações entre tecnologias e dispositivos. Normalmente, são feitas através dos mais diversos periféricos, onde podemos citar: mouses, teclados, telas sensíveis a toque (touch­screen), canetas óticas, Joystics etc. Esta diversidade fornece ao usuário uma forma amigável de integração com o sistema computacional.
Figura 3: Joystick
Figura 4: Caneta Ótica
Figura 5: Touch-screen
Em computadores pessoais que utilizam interfaces gráficas, a forma básica de interação é a utilização de dispositivos de apontamento, tais como o mouse, que controlam a posição de um cursor na tela. Os diálogos entre o sistema e o usuário se dão através de caixas de mensagens que solicitam uma resposta do usuário ou o informam sobre algum acontecimento do sistema. As aplicações são apresentadas na forma de janelas e são representadas através de ícones. As operações disponíveis nas aplicações aparecem na forma de opções organizadas em menus ou como botões em barras de ferramentas. A metáfora de Área de trabalho (ou desktop) que é comum às interfaces gráficas, vê a tela de seu computador como a “topo” da sua mesa de trabalho em seu escritório. Dispositivos móveis como PDAs e Smartphones também usam interfaces gráficas, mas com outros tipos de metáforas, devido às limitações de recurso no próprio dispositivo.
4.1.3.1 Elementos Básicos das Interfaces Gráficas
ÁREA DE TRABALHO
A área de trabalho, ou desktop, é a região da tela onde todos os aplicativos gráficos são lançados. Programas gerenciadores de janelas são responsáveis pela manipulação das janelas de aplicação presentes na área de trabalho. Figura 6: Windows Vista
Figura 7: Linux Educacional
Figura 8: MAC
JANELAS
Uma janela de programa é a estrutura de interface de um aplicativo. Quando um aplicativo é executado no computador, uma janela de programa é exibida na área de trabalho e um botão é adicionado na barra de tarefas. Figura 9: Janela de programa
(1) A caixa de menu de controle está posicionada no canto superior esquerdo na barra de título da janela. Esta caixa contém todas as opções de manipulação de janela. (2) A barra de título exibe o nome do aplicativo e, em alguns casos, exibe também nome do documento que está sendo tratado por ele. (3) Os botões de manipulação da janela estão posicionados no canto superior direito na barra de título. Dos quatro botões existentes (minimizar, restaurar, maximizar e fechar), só três aparecem simultaneamente na janela de um aplicativo. (4) A barra de menus contém todas as operações disponíveis no aplicativo. Estas estão divididas por temas e agrupadas por finidade. (5) A barra de ferramentas contém um conjunto de botões associados às operações mais freqüentemente utilizadas no aplicativo.
(6) A área de trabalho da janela corresponde ao espaço disponível no aplicativo para o trabalho real da aplicação.
(7) As barras de rolagem vertical e horizontal possibilitam o rolamento da área de trabalho da janela, mostrando áreas ocultas do documento. (8) A barras de status está posicionada na parte inferior da janela. Ela exibe algumas informações adicionais do programa.
MENUS
Os menus são estruturas que agrupam, na forma de listas, o conjunto total ou parcial dos comando de um aplicativo. Os menus agilizam o uso dos programas, pois eliminam a necessidade de memorização de seqüências de comandos, já que estes estão grupados de forma clara e estruturada. Um menu de contexto é tipo de especial de menu que é aberto com o segundo botão do mouse. Menus de contexto permitem ao usuário acessar rapidamente opções relacionadas à posição do cursor de mouse de uma aplicação. Estas opções mudarão de acordo com o objeto que está selecionado ou de acordo com sua localização do cursor na aplicação.
ÍCONES E ATALHOS
São representações gráficas de algum objeto, conceito ou ação existentes no computador, tais como: documentos, aplicativos, periféricos, comandos em um programa e etc. Figura 10: Exemplos de ícones
Os ícones, rapidamente, foram adotados como a forma básica de executar um aplicativo nas interfaces gráficas. Uma vez que um ícone é uma representação visual de ação ou objeto sua função é transmitir a compreensão de seu conceito assim que é visto.
CURSORES E PONTEIROS
A medida que você navega em um aplicativo, passando pelos vários elementos que constituem a tela de sua aplicação, o ponteiro do mouse modifica sua aparência fornecendo informações adicionais a respeito da área na qual se encontra. Figura 11:Alguns ponteiros de mouse
CAIXAS DE MENSAGEM
As caixas de mensagens são formas de dialogo entre o sistema operacional e os usuários. Através das caixas de mensagens o sistema espera a resposta a uma pergunta ou, informa sobre ações selecionadas.
Figura 12: Caixa de Diálogo: Salvar alterações
BARRA DE TAREFAS
A Barra de Tarefas normalmente é encontrada na parte inferior da área de trabalho das interfaces gráficas. Nela, os aplicativos que estão em execução são representados na forma de botões. Podemos entender a barra de tarefas como um “controle remoto” onde os botões, quando pressionados, selecionam o aplicativo relacionado, semelhante a um “canal de TV”.
Figura 13: Barra de Tarefas
Ainda na barra de tarefas encontramos a área de notificação, nela aparece o relógio do sistema e alguns ícones de programas que estão trabalhando em segundo plano, tais como: antivírus, firewall, configuradores de vídeo etc.
Download